Can you uncorrupt a Minecraft world?

This can easily be done by restoring and "Re-creating" a backup of LostWorld. If no backup exists, you must manually create a new world. Make sure seed and map generator settings match those of LostWorld to avoid chunk error. The inventory (i.e. the things you were carrying) from BlankWorld world will be used.

What does the Dryad say when the world is 100% corrupt?

So to answer your question, in a fully Corrupt world, the Dryad would say "Things are grim indeed...", and in a fully Hallowed world, the Dryad would say "We are living in a fairy tale."

How to uncorrupt a biome?

Contain your evil biomes by digging a tunnel around them before you enter Hardmode. After entering Hardmode, start saving up for a Clentaminator, which will purify your biomes. Use Green Solution with the Clentaminator to get rid of Crimson, Corrupted, or Hallow.

What happens if your whole world gets corrupted?

As soon as you enter Hardmode in Terraria, the world's Corruption, Crimson, and the new Hallow biome all start to expand outwards. Rapidly. If left to their own devices, these biomes will eventually swallow your entire world, destroying your NPC villages and making life generally difficult.

Why Minecraft worlds get corrupted?

We are sorry to hear that your Minecraft world got corrupted. This can happen when you load a world in a newer version and then go back to an older one, because the game may not be able to read the changes made by the newer version.

How do you uncorrupt player data in Minecraft?

You can do this via the gamepanel's File Manager or via FTP. Within your world folder, navigate to the playerdata folder, and then open it. Find and select the file which has the same name as that user's UUID, and then delete it. Restart your server for the change to take effect.

What item gets rid of corruption?

The Clentaminator (and its upgrade) is the fastest means of spreading/removing Hallow, Corruption and Crimson. It converts Grass, Trees, Ice, Sand, and Stone, but NOT between mud and dirt.

How to get 0% Corruption?

Once the biome is purified, search the surface and make sure there are no additional Crimson biomes. Talk to the Dryad. Select the "Status" option so she'll tell you how much Crimson/Corruption you have. Hopefully she'll report 0% and the achievement will pop.

Does the Dryad turn into a tree?

The quote "What's this about me having more 'bark' than bite?" is a possible joke about the fact that the Dryad could manipulate nature and hence appear as a tree. This could also be a reference to her not cleansing the world evil herself despite claiming that she fought the Old One's Army.

How to uncorrupt a Minecraft world bedrock?

Open Minecraft: Bedrock Edition and head to your list of worlds. Select the pencil button to the right of your corrupted world to open its edit menu. Scroll down to the bottom of the game settings menu and press the "copy world" button. Return to the world list, and you'll notice a copy of your corrupted world.
